SUMMARY:

In this customer-facing role, the Relationship Banker I will provide exceptional customer care to the Bank’s customers assisting them with banking transactions, addressing inquiries and assisting with problem resolution at a full-service Cape Cod 5 Retail Banking Center location.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S/R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Develops rapport with customers, greeting customers by name, understand account ownership types and authority, being responsive and timely with correspondence and problem resolution, while display a caring attitude (GUEST philosophy)
  • Provide excellent customer care to customers relative to daily transactions, addressing inquiries, and problem resolution, in accordance with Bank policies and procedures
  • Performs basic banking transactions including processing deposits and loan payments, verifying cash and endorsements, check cashing, money orders and treasurer’s check issuance and savings bond redemption
  • Safeguards customer trust by upholding duty of customer confidentiality
  • Works to develop a comprehensive knowledge of the Bank’s products and services offered, taking responsibility to request assistance for further development needs
  • Must comply with all required laws, regulations, policies, and procedures
  • Timely completion of all assigned learning activities
  • Actively participate in Banking Center meetings and one-on-one coaching sessions
  • Participation/volunteerism in community groups and events
  • Additional duties as assigned
